Quoting another FAG contributor and agreeing.
"I think it is a real shame what FindAGrave has evolved into. What started as a noble way to link people with graves of loved ones they could never hope to see, and with the generations that had preceded them, has turned into a game for some. Memorials have turned into a kind of "trading card", a competition of who can own the most memorials and post the highest numbers and enter the memorial first!! What has been forgotten by many is that these were people, loved in life and death, not a commodity to be traded or owned.
With my apologies to those that have pure motives. I hope there are more of us than there are of them".
Or a game of getting back at others, as well, instead of trying to work with one another, you chose to work against each other. If only we could all start from scratch and just get along think how wonderful this site would be?
